X235 With reference to your enquiry as to the oil which we shall recommend for customers use for re-filling their hydraulic shock dampers. We think that Gargoyle Mobiloil 'E', which is obtainable in quart, ½-gall., and one-gall. cans, will be satisfactory for this purpose. This oil is obtainable at all garages throughout the country. Will you please therefore recommend in the Instruction Book that customers use the oil in question. Hs{Lord Ernest Hives - Chair}/Rm.{William Robotham - Chief Engineer} | ||
